Chui P.S. If the blade goes tits up and you are keen on hanging onto the rather nice olive wood handle then you can remove the virole, tap the pivot pin out and drop a new blade in

Thanks, It's still comfortable in the hand and waaay better in the pocket, for me anyways. Yes, the black is from charring with a plumbers torch. I hit it with the torch, brushed it with a brass brush and rubbed it down with mineral oil.I like that. You have flattened the sides more than I ever thought of doing. How did you get the black color, flame?
Henry Beige , I made a edit to my previous post to add I sanded the lacquer off before hitting it with the torch.
